Steak Sliders with Cowboy Butter
Juicy pieces of seared marinated steak served on brioche buns with caramelized onions, smoked provolone cheese, and a rich herb and spice butter.

Ingredients
- 2 lb ribeye or sirloin steak (cut into strips)
- 2 tsp Worcestershire sauce
- 2 tsp garlic powder
- 1 tsp soy sauce
- salt and pepper (to taste (generous amount))
- 8 oz smoked provolone cheese (sliced)
- 2 tbsp avocado oil (for searing)
- 12 brioche slider buns (one standard pack)
- 2.5 yellow onion (medium, sliced)
- 1 tsp granulated sugar
- salt (a generous pinch for the onions)
- 8 tbsp unsalted butter (for the cowboy butter)
- 5 garlic (minced cloves)
- 1 shallot (minced)
- 0.5 lemon (freshly squeezed)
- 1 tbsp Dijon mustard
- 1 tbsp parsley (chopped (heaping tablespoon))
- 1 tbsp chives (chopped (heaping tablespoon))
- 1 tsp thyme
- 1 tsp cayenne pepper (adjust to taste)
- 0.5 tsp red chili flakes
- 0.5 tsp smoked paprika
- 0.25 cup unsalted butter (melted, for the garlic butter)
- 2 tbsp fresh parsley (freshly chopped)
- 1 tsp garlic powder (heaping teaspoon for the topping)
Steps
- 1
In a large bowl, mix the steak strips with the Worcestershire sauce, 2 tsp garlic powder, soy sauce, salt, and pepper. Ensure the meat is well coated and let marinate while preparing the rest of the ingredients.
- 2
For the caramelized onions, heat a little oil in a skillet over medium heat. Add the sliced onions, sugar, and a pinch of salt. Cook, stirring occasionally, until they are golden brown and soft.
- 3
Prepare the cowboy butter: in a small skillet or bowl, combine the 8 tbsp of butter, minced garlic, shallot, lemon juice, Dijon mustard, parsley, chives, thyme, cayenne, chili flakes, smoked paprika, and salt to taste. Mix well until fully combined.
- 4
Heat the avocado oil in a large skillet over high heat. Sear the steak strips in batches to avoid crowding the pan, cooking until well browned on the outside but still juicy inside. Remove from heat.
- 5
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). Slice the brioche buns horizontally in half (do not separate individual buns if they come in a connected block).
- 6
Place the bottom half of the buns on a baking sheet. Spread a generous layer of the cowboy butter over the bread.
- 7
Distribute the seared steak strips over the butter, followed by the caramelized onions and the smoked provolone cheese slices.
- 8
Place the top half of the buns over the cheese.
- 9
Prepare the garlic butter by mixing the 1/4 cup melted butter with the chopped parsley, garlic powder, and salt. Generously brush the tops of the buns with this mixture.
- 10
Bake for 10-15 minutes or until the cheese is completely melted and the tops of the buns are golden and crispy.
Notes
You can use ribeye for a more intense flavor and higher fat content, or sirloin for a leaner option. Adjust the cayenne pepper according to your spice tolerance.
